Windows Media Service全攻略(一) |
|
|
|
一、簡介 Windows Media Service 是微軟出品的一套媒體伺服器軟體,在 Windows 2000 Server 和 Windows 2000 Advanced Server 是預設被安裝的組件,同時會自動在系統中建立 NetShow 使用者和 NetShowService 使用者組。 Windows Media Service 提供完整的媒體伺服器所需的一切功能,並內建 Windows Media Encoder 編碼器,可將普通的媒體檔案轉換成 Windows Media 的流媒體格式檔案 --- asf。 Windows Media Service 可以運行在專門的 MMS 流媒體協議下,就算是窄帶網路也同樣可以方便地訪問到媒體檔案。 Windows Media 服務 安裝:
運行: 開始菜單-程式-管理工具-Windows Media 可以開啟 Windows Media 管理介面:
Windows Media 編碼器 在預設情況下,Windows Media Encoder 會和 Windows Media Service一起安裝,在開始菜單中開啟 Windows Media 可看見一下介面:
Windows Media Service 的基本術語 以下是微軟對 Windows Media Service 部分使用術語的官方解釋。
- 單播:用戶端與伺服器之間的點到點串連。“點到點”指每個用戶端都從伺服器接收遠程流。僅當用戶端發出請求時,才發送單播流。
- 多播:通過啟用多播網路傳遞的內容流;網路中的所有用戶端共用同一流。
- 點播串連:是用戶端與伺服器之間的主動的串連。在點播串連中,使用者通過選擇內容項目來初始化用戶端串連。內容以 ASF 流從伺服器傳到用戶端。若檔案已被編入索引,則使用者可以開始、停止、後退、快進或暫停流。點播串連提供了對流的最大控制,但這種方式由於每個用戶端各自串連伺服器,卻會迅速用完網路頻寬。
- 廣播:指的是使用者被動接收流。在廣播過程中,用戶端接收流,但不能控制流程。例如,使用者不能暫停、快進或後退該流共有兩類廣播:單播和多播,兩種都是被動的。
“點播單播發布點”用來提供 .asf 檔案。 “廣播單播發布點”用來提供實況 ASF 流。
|
|
|
|
補充日期: 2005-04-26 09:42:11
Windows Media Service全攻略(二) |
|
|
|
|
二、單播 建立點播單播站 點播單播站相當於建立一個媒體檔案伺服器,這主要是這對靜態媒體檔案的。 Windows Media Service 已預設建立了一個媒體檔案存放路徑,位於系統根區下的 asfroot 下,把媒體檔案放到該目錄下就可以了,安裝好 Windows Media Service 後可以用 Windows Media Player 以串連本機伺服器的方式訪問 Windows Media Service 的樣本媒體檔案: 輸入樣本媒體檔案的路徑 當然,這個 asfroot 的路徑是可以更改的,Windows Media Service 也支援建立多個點播單播網站,需要注意的是,在建立點播單播網站時,標識為 <Home> 的是網站的預設媒體檔案存放路徑。 建立別名為 mp3 的點播單播網站 網站建立好後,訪問者只要輸入 mms://伺服器/(別名,Home 可省略)/媒體檔案 就可以訪問媒體伺服器上的媒體檔案了;當然,Windows Media Service是可以限制頻寬和訪問者人數的。 建立廣播單播站 在單播的方式下可以建立一個單播的廣播站,這些廣播站的媒體源可以是 Windows Media Encoder (編碼器),也可以是遠端 Windows Media Service 網站。 下面介紹如何在單播方式下建立一個現場廣播電台:
建立廣播站 設定媒體源 --- 編碼器的路徑和連接埠,其中別名需要設定妥當,因為訪問格式是 mms://伺服器IP/別名 。
廣播站已建立 訪問者只需要輸入 mms://伺服器/benson 就可以訪問到這個廣播站了,當然廣播站的設定路經一定要有效。 使用編碼器向廣播站發送媒體流: 在開始菜單中開啟 Windows Media Service 內建的編碼器 Windows Media Encoder 。 開啟後選中檔案,選擇建立,再選擇自訂方式建立:
選擇擷取裝置,這裡只選擇捕獲音訊裝置。 選擇實際的頻寬 單擊完成,完成編碼器的設定。 編碼器和伺服器串連成功 串連廣播站 現在已用單播建立一個廣播站了,上面的例子是建立遠程 Windows Media Encoder 的廣播站,以後會繼續介紹 Windows Media Encoder 的詳細用法。 |
|
|
|
補充日期: 2005-04-26 09:43:12
Windows Media Service全攻略(三) |
|
|
|
三、多播 Windows Media Service 的多播可以指定動態或靜態遠程媒體檔案或直接和 Windows Media Encoder 串連,下面以建立現場直播的多播站為例:設定管理員: 通過嚮導建立多播廣播站 輸入該站的名稱,訪問者通過 mms://伺服器IP/多播廣播站名稱 來訪問。 設定節目名,一個多播廣播站可建立多個節目,一個節目又可建立或串連多個流。 選擇流源是 Windows 編碼器 輸入這個編碼器的 URL, 該串連使用 msbd 協議。 接下來嚮導會詢問是否儲存等資訊,一直按下一步,最後選擇關閉就可以了。 伺服器多播廣播站成功建立,為遠程編碼器未開啟時的返回資訊。 配置 Windows Media Encoder: 和配置單播時一樣,通過簡單設定就可以配置好 Windows Media Encoder。
選擇編碼器的音訊輸出格式 發送到 Windows Media 伺服器 指定連接埠,注意,設定連接埠時應確認該連接埠的狀態是閒置。 Windows Media Encoder 的資訊按鈕變成綠色,代表串連已正常。 可以看到 Windows Media 伺服器的串連資訊 |
|
|
|